Arrowhead Spiketail vs Mt Pirri Deermouse
Cordulegaster obliqua compared with Isthmomys pirrensis
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Arrowhead Spiketail | Mt Pirri Deermouse |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Arthropoda (Arthropods)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Insecta (Insects) | Mammalia (Mammals) |
| Order | Odonata (Odonata) | Rodentia (Rodents) |
| Family | Cordulegastridae | Cricetidae |
| Genus | Cordulegaster | Isthmomys |
| Species | Cordulegaster obliqua | Isthmomys pirrensis |
Evolutionary Relationship
Arrowhead Spiketail and Mt Pirri Deermouse share a common ancestor at the Kingdom level: Animalia. (Animals)
